Firehouse Subs at Newark Airport is a solid quick stop before a flight. The sandwiches are hot, filling, and the portions are generous. The turkey sub is definitely the best, really fresh and tastes great. It’s a little pricey, but that’s expected at the airport. Overall, a good choice.

Firehouse Subs at Newark Airport was a really solid choice, especially for airport food. The sandwiches were fresh, hot, and packed with flavor, the bread was soft but still held everything together, and the meats and toppings didn’t feel skimpy at all. You can tell they actually put effort into making it taste like a real sub shop, not just a rushed airport version.
The service was pretty quick too, which is important when you’re trying to catch a flight. The staff was friendly and kept the line moving, even when it got busy. Overall, it’s definitely one of the better spots to grab a filling meal at the airport, and I’d go there again over most other options in Newark.
